Index: net/tools/quic/quic_time_wait_list_manager.cc |
diff --git a/net/tools/quic/quic_time_wait_list_manager.cc b/net/tools/quic/quic_time_wait_list_manager.cc |
index 38badb1701941db88798bcaec174c45defe6a375..8edd2db7cf7fbdf46a5165c31e631c668e4e201b 100644 |
--- a/net/tools/quic/quic_time_wait_list_manager.cc |
+++ b/net/tools/quic/quic_time_wait_list_manager.cc |
@@ -76,11 +76,12 @@ class QuicTimeWaitListManager::QueuedPacket { |
QuicTimeWaitListManager::QuicTimeWaitListManager( |
QuicPacketWriter* writer, |
QuicServerSessionVisitor* visitor, |
- QuicConnectionHelperInterface* helper) |
+ QuicConnectionHelperInterface* helper, |
+ QuicAlarmFactory* alarm_factory) |
: time_wait_period_( |
QuicTime::Delta::FromSeconds(FLAGS_quic_time_wait_list_seconds)), |
connection_id_clean_up_alarm_( |
- helper->CreateAlarm(new ConnectionIdCleanUpAlarm(this))), |
+ alarm_factory->CreateAlarm(new ConnectionIdCleanUpAlarm(this))), |
clock_(helper->GetClock()), |
writer_(writer), |
visitor_(visitor) { |